Example 2

If B and Q are acute angles such that sin B = sin Q, prove that B = Q.

Two right triangles ABC and PQR with equal acute angles B and Q marked for comparison.
Figure 8-9 from the supplied NCERT chapter.

Solution

Board-exam working:

Consider right triangles ABC and PQR as shown.

sinB=ACAB,sinQ=PRPQ\sin B=\frac{AC}{AB},\qquad \sin Q=\frac{PR}{PQ}
ACAB=PRPQ\frac{AC}{AB}=\frac{PR}{PQ}
ACPR=ABPQ=k\frac{AC}{PR}=\frac{AB}{PQ}=k

By the Pythagoras theorem:

BC=AB2AC2,QR=PQ2PR2BC=\sqrt{AB^2-AC^2},\qquad QR=\sqrt{PQ^2-PR^2}
BCQR=k2PQ2k2PR2PQ2PR2=k\frac{BC}{QR}=\frac{\sqrt{k^2PQ^2-k^2PR^2}}{\sqrt{PQ^2-PR^2}}=k
ACPR=ABPQ=BCQR\frac{AC}{PR}=\frac{AB}{PQ}=\frac{BC}{QR}

Therefore, △ACB ∼ △PRQ by SSS similarity. Corresponding angles are equal.

B=Q\angle B=\angle Q

Final answer

Hence, ∠B = ∠Q.
